Job Description:
West Fraser's Henderson sawmill is hiring for an entry-level
general labor role. The Operator Apprentice position is an
entry-level role with the expectation that self-motivated
individuals will advance into progressively skilled positions. The
successful applicant will be allowed an appropriate amount of time
to train for this job and must be willing to cross-train within any
department. What you will do: Must be willing to perform entry
level lumberyard duties, housekeeping duties, including use of a
shovel, ground keeping, painting, janitorial, etc. Must be willing
to stack various lengths of lumber May be assigned tasks indoors
and outdoors, no matter the weather conditions Monitor lumber
movement Move lumber through the process ensuring no lumber
cross-ups Clear jammed lumber as necessary Assist others as
necessary Perform quality checks Perform safety observations Follow
all Safe Work Procedures Follow all Zero Energy State procedures
Utilize downtime or slow time to enhance the appearance and
productivity of the department Perform all job assignments in an
effective and timely manner with minimal supervision Operate
necessary equipment according to procedures Monitor assigned area
and related area visually and via monitor screen. Remove/straighten
out cross-ups using pike pole or picaroon Inspection of equipment
Servicing and minor adjustments to the equipment (when necessary)
Preventative maintenance Assist maintenance with servicing of
equipment Cleaning of the equipment Documentation and reporting of
results Daily greasing of necessary equipment and/or related
equipment What you need to be successful: High School Diploma or
GED Minimum age of 18 years Excellent safety record Follow all
safety criteria and contribute to the safety program Follow all
electrical safety standards Willing to work any shift Good written
and oral communication skills Good interpersonal skills Excellent
attendance record Demonstrable mechanical aptitude Basic
maintenance skills Capability to troubleshoot issues and diagnose
problems within the department and/or related equipment. Able to
maintain or assist with maintaining the assigned area and/or
related equipment. Capability to perform preventative maintenance
on your assigned machine Able to climb ladders and work in elevated
workplaces Capable of working in tight close spaces Ability to make
quality control checks and adjustments at the assigned area and/or
other related equipment. Ability to keep the department clean and
meet housekeeping standards. Willingness and ability to learn and
use some basic computer-related operating skills Willing to train
others within the department and/or related equipment Willing to
cross-train on other equipment What will make you stand out:

inquiries, please. West Fraser is a diversified wood products
company producing lumber, OSB, LVL, MDF, plywood, pulp, newsprint,
wood chips, and energy with over 60 facilities in Canada, the
United States, and Europe. We are the largest lumber producer in
North America, a leading global manufacturer of wood-based panels,
and the world’s largest producer of oriented strand board (OSB). We
